Home demolition services involve the careful dismantling and removal of entire residential structures. This process typically includes the systematic tearing down of walls, roofing, flooring, and other building components, often utilizing specialized equipment to ensure efficiency and safety. Contractors may also handle the removal of debris and materials, preparing the site for future construction or landscaping projects. The scope of demolition can vary from complete teardown of an entire house to selective demolition of specific sections or features, depending on the project requirements.

Cost Range - Home demolition services typically cost between $4,000 and $15,000, depending on the size and complexity of the structure. For example, a small residential garage demolition may be around $4,000, while a full house teardown could reach $15,000 or more.
Factors Affecting Cost - The total expense varies based on factors such as building materials, accessibility, and the presence of hazardous materials. Demolishing a brick home in Union County might cost approximately $10,000, whereas a wooden frame house could be closer to $6,000.
Additional Expenses - Costs for permits, debris removal, and site cleanup are usually separate but can add $1,000 to $3,000 to the overall project. These expenses depend on local regulations and the extent of debris involved.
Typical Price Range - Overall, homeowners should budget between $5,000 and $20,000 for home demolition services, with prices varying based on project specifics and local contractor rates. Contact local service providers for detailed estimates tailored to individual properties.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of structures can home demolition services handle? Local demolition contractors typically handle houses, garages, sheds, and other residential structures, ensuring safe and efficient removal.
How do demolition professionals prepare a property for demolition? They assess the site, obtain necessary permits, disconnect utilities, and plan for debris removal to ensure a smooth process.
Are there any permits required for home demolition? Permit requirements vary by location; contacting local authorities or demolition service providers can provide guidance on necessary approvals.
What should homeowners do before demolition begins? Homeowners should clear the property of personal items, inform neighbors if needed, and coordinate with the demolition contractor on access and logistics.
How is debris managed after demolition? Local service providers typically handle debris removal, ensuring proper disposal or recycling according to local regulations.
